All the hotels in question for White Lotus Season 4

The team’s Paris hotel visits included the legendary Le Lutetia, a five-star gem perched on the Left Bank of the Seine in the stylish Saint-Germain-des-Prés district. Opened in 1910, the Art Deco landmark, now part of the Mandarin Oriental group, has long been a magnet for the greats, from Charlie Chaplin and Ernest Hemingway to Pablo Picasso and Josephine Baker.

Another contender for The White Lotus’ new season is the equally storied Ritz Paris, which first welcomed guests in 1898. Known for its timeless opulence, it was once the popular spot for personalities such as Coco Chanel, F. Scott Fitzgerald, and Marcel Proust.
